What is Blooket?
Blooket is an internet based learning platform that permits teachers to generate fun games as well as quizzes for the students. This platform utilises a game technician and engaging components to inspire students to learn and review classroom content. Blooket gives various game modes such as racing, crypto, and towers of treasure.
With the help of Blooket Login, teachers can generate classes, include students, and review activities. They have already made templates on several school subjects that teachers can utilize. Also, teachers can monitor students’ progress and find out the reason for the lack of learning.
Features of Blooket Login
Here are some of the unique features of blooket that you should get to know about in detail:
Major Game Modes: Bloket offers more than 15 specific modes such as classic, gold quest, tower defense, crypto, racing and cafe. Every mode has different mechanics, like managing resources and clashes for different subjects. The teachers choose the moods while hosting, on the other hand, students enjoy powerups, timed increases, and leaderboards for the competition.
Content Generation Tools: Personalised questions with quizzes with text, photos, videos, and audio. Generating the question bank for speedy imports from any set smoothly. Also, verifying the curriculum by professionals from maths, science, history, and many more.
Student Interactiveness Features: The students can personalise avatars with more than 250 characters, utilising earned tokens. Some features contain bonus tokens post-game, self-paced homework modes and group learning.
Teacher Dashboard: The login dashboard contains reports, reply times, individual breakdowns, and class trends. Reporting data, assigning homework within a year deadline, and monitoring progress over time.
How does Blooket work?
The entire Blooket working process is simple and does not involve any complex process. Given below, let’s see in detail the work process:
Get a Question set: Teachers can begin on the Blooket dashboard by clicking on “Create” for personalised sets and explore over one lakh templates on various subjects such as Maths and History. You can also import the question sets.
Select a Game Mode: From more than 15 modes, select a game mode as per your goals. You can even preview modes, see settings, and host to create a Game ID or a sharing link.
Play the Game: The students join through the website and fill in the code. You just need to answer the questions to earn the scores and tokens. You can even compete on the leaderboards with team modes.
Learn & Analyse: After the game, teachers can see live dashboards with precise rates, reply times, and replays. The students view personal stats as well as open rewards.

How do Teachers Monitor Student Progress?
The Booklet login offers teachers full visibility into students’ game outcomes, including progress and analytics. Also, on the spot, they know which types of questions students mostly get wrong. Some of the additional tracking capabilities include:
- Reviewing the person and the holistic class performance report.
- You can replay any game session to know the exact student reply structures.
- Monitor time spent and interaction phases during a game.
- Exporting full game analytics for depth analysis.
Use Cases and Applications of Blooket Login
Given below are the details of use cases and applications of blooket login, presented in a table:
| Use Cases | Applications |
| Classroom Review Sessions | Teachers host live multiplayer games for quiz reviews in subjects like math, science, or history to reinforce lessons. |
| Homework Assignments | Assign self-paced games with deadlines for students to practice independently and track progress. |
| Vocabulary Building | Use modes like Gold Quest or Cafe for language arts, helping students memorise terms through gamified repetition. |
| Group Competitions | Team-based modes foster collaboration and friendly rivalry during class time or events. |
| Special Education | Accessibility features like high-contrast and adjustable fonts support diverse learners. |
| Professional Development | Customise for adult training in corporate settings, such as compliance quizzes or skill drills. |

Blooket login: Pros and Cons
Given below are the Pros and Cons of blooket login that are important for you to analyse:
| Pros | Cons |
| Free core features with a 60-player limit | Premium needed for large classes |
| Easy guest join, no app required | Browser-dependent, occasional lag |
| Strong analytics and integrations | Limited non-English support |
| Fun gamification boosts engagement | Data privacy concerns for schools |
